| 网站首页 | 业界新闻 | 小组 | 威客 | 人才 | 下载频道 | 博客 | 代码贴 | 在线编程 | 编程论坛
欢迎加入我们,一同切磋技术
用户名:   
 
密 码:  
共有 1011 人关注过本帖
标题:可以把多条记录放到一个字段中吗
只看楼主 加入收藏
guaishi
Rank: 1
等 级:新手上路
帖 子:156
专家分:0
注 册:2007-6-15
结帖率:100%
收藏
 问题点数:0 回复次数:8 
可以把多条记录放到一个字段中吗
我想实现这样一个功能
有很多选项可供用户选择,如果按常理,用户每选一个就要在数据库中增加一个字段,这样很麻烦而且用户的选项可以无限,我想用一个字段来保存可以吗,如果可以我要对它进行查询和分类的操作有如何来进行呀
搜索更多相关主题的帖子: 字段 数据库 记录 选项 用户 
2007-11-01 09:47
purana
Rank: 16Rank: 16Rank: 16Rank: 16
来 自:广东-广州
等 级:版主
威 望:66
帖 子:6039
专家分:0
注 册:2005-6-17
收藏
得分:0 
用户提交之后..你自己去处理就是了.

我的msn: myfend@
2007-11-01 10:08
yms123
Rank: 16Rank: 16Rank: 16Rank: 16
等 级:版主
威 望:209
帖 子:12488
专家分:19042
注 册:2004-7-17
收藏
得分:0 
可以完全没有问题用一个字段,将不同值使用分隔符分隔即可。比如"网上查找|朋友推荐|报纸浏览|其他"
2007-11-01 10:14
hmhz
Rank: 7Rank: 7Rank: 7
等 级:贵宾
威 望:30
帖 子:1890
专家分:503
注 册:2006-12-17
收藏
得分:0 
楼上说的对,可以放一个字段里,用分隔符号分开,读取的时候采用分组
counts="网上查找|朋友推荐|报纸浏览|其他"
NB=split(counts,"|")
<%=NB(0)%> '网上查找
<%=NB(1)%> '朋友推荐
<%=NB(2)%> '报纸浏览
<%=NB(3)%> '其他




[编程论坛] ASP超级群:49158383  敲门暗号:ASP编程
龍艺博客 http://www.
2007-11-01 11:35
guaishi
Rank: 1
等 级:新手上路
帖 子:156
专家分:0
注 册:2007-6-15
收藏
得分:0 

谢谢你们,我明白了


网络改变了我,编程改变了我的生活
2007-11-02 09:31
guaishi
Rank: 1
等 级:新手上路
帖 子:156
专家分:0
注 册:2007-6-15
收藏
得分:0 


<%set conn=server.createobject("adodb.connection")
constr="Provider=Microsoft.Jet.OLEDB.4.0;data source="&server.MapPath("index.mdb")
conn.open constr%>
<body>
<%dim a
a=request.form("text1")
a=a&"|"&request.form("text2")&"|"&request("text3")&"|"&request("text4")
set rb=server.CreateObject("adodb.recordset")
sql="select * from index "
rb.open sql,conn,1,3
rb.addnew
rb("jihe")=a
rb.update
response.write("更新成功")%>
<%set rs=server.CreateObject("adodb.recordset")
sql="index"
rs.open sql,conn,1,1

%>
<%if rs.recordcount=0 then
response.write("没有记录")%>
<%else%>
<%for i=1 to rs.recordcount %>
<%dim b,c
b=rs("jihe")
c=split(b,"|")%>
<table width="200" border="1">
<tr>
<td><span class="STYLE1">选项1</span></td>
<td><%=c(0)%></td>
</tr>
<tr>
<td><span class="STYLE2">选项2</span></td>
<td><%=c(1)%></td>
</tr>
<tr>
<td><span class="STYLE3">选项3</span></td>
<td><%=c(2)%></td>
</tr>
<tr>
<td><span class="STYLE4">选项4</span></td>
<td><%=c(3)%></td>
</tr>
</table>
<%rs.movenext%>
<%next%>
<%end if%>
Microsoft JET Database Engine 错误 '80040e14'

FROM 子句语法错误。

/text/index2.asp,行 37


网络改变了我,编程改变了我的生活
2007-11-02 11:02
星梦缘
Rank: 1
来 自:江西
等 级:新手上路
帖 子:413
专家分:0
注 册:2007-1-16
收藏
得分:0 

shift+\```````````````用来分隔


show出自己 活力四射!
2007-11-02 11:19
guaishi
Rank: 1
等 级:新手上路
帖 子:156
专家分:0
注 册:2007-6-15
收藏
得分:0 

谢谢你,这个问题我解决了


网络改变了我,编程改变了我的生活
2007-11-05 13:42
guaishi
Rank: 1
等 级:新手上路
帖 子:156
专家分:0
注 册:2007-6-15
收藏
得分:0 
我想做一个文本框要按用户的输入而输出
如何做呢
请高手回答

网络改变了我,编程改变了我的生活
2007-11-05 15:01
快速回复:可以把多条记录放到一个字段中吗
数据加载中...
 
   



关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.069421 second(s), 8 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ved